Why is my Karcher carpet cleaner not spraying water?

Step #1 Check the Water Level To get your carpet cleaner on the road to recovery, you will first need to check the water and formula levels. Make sure there is enough water and formula in both tanks. If the water or formula levels are low, the carpet cleaner will not be able to spray.

Why won't my carpet cleaner pick up water?

Your carpet cleaner might think its filter is too clogged for you to continue cleaning and will stop. This could be the reason for the suction problem. The filter might also be too blocked for the unit to be able to suck. This is because the water will not be able to pass through the machine and cause a backlog.

Why is my carpet cleaner not working?

Jiggle the tank to ensure it is making a good connection to the machine. Check your filters and make sure all of the doors and latches are properly closed so that the machine can achieve a good suction. Dirty filters will also cause problems, so always check before you start the wet process of cleaning flooring.

How do you remove an extractor fan cover?

To remove your fan cover, you will usually need to unscrew it and lift or slide it off. Some extractor fans will also have spring clips which you'll need to undo. Once you have removed the cover, fill a container with soapy water and leave it to soak.
